According to the research report, "United States Laptop Market Outlook, 2031," published by Bonafide Research, the United States Laptop Market is anticipated to grow at more than 4.87% CAGR from 2026 to 2031.Beyond basic product types and applications the US laptop market is shaped by fierce competition among established giants and emerging challengers. Dell HP Apple Lenovo and Microsoft continue to dominate but brands like Acer ASUS and Samsung are gaining traction with premium designs and specialized features. A major driver is the ongoing shift toward hybrid work and education models which has extended replacement cycles while also raising expectations for battery life camera quality and build durability. Technological innovation remains a powerful catalyst. The integration of AI assisted processors e g Intel Core Ultra AMD Ryzen 7000 series with NPUs is redefining productivity and creative workflows. Likewise the adoption of OLED and high refresh rate displays is moving beyond gaming laptops into mainstream ultraportables. Pricing trends show a bifurcation. Sub 500 Chromebooks and entry level Windows devices appeal to budget conscious schools and households. 500 to 1500 range devices serve mainstream users. 1500 plus premium models MacBook Pro Dell XPS Microsoft Surface capture growing demand for creator and AI ready machines. Windows remains the enterprise standard but macOS continues to gain share in professional creative sectors and Chrome OS has solidified its presence in K 12 education. Finally the rise of always connected PCs with 5G and Wi Fi 7 integration is enabling real time collaboration and cloud centric workflows further decoupling laptop performance from local storage limits.
US consumer behavior toward laptops has evolved from simple ownership to performance tailored multi device ecosystems. The average household now often maintains both a lightweight portable 13 to 14 inch for daily browsing and a larger more powerful machine for gaming or content creation. Educational institutions particularly universities are requiring students to purchase devices that meet specific software compatibility e g engineering CAD data science tools driving demand for higher RAM dedicated GPUs and faster SSDs. Geographically the Northeast and West Coast lead in premium laptop adoption due to higher concentrations of tech centric jobs and startup activity whereas the Midwest and South see stronger demand for rugged value oriented models used in field services and agriculture. First the maturation of on device AI will enable real time language translation advanced noise suppression and predictive battery management without cloud dependency. Second the push for repairability spurred by state level right to repair laws is forcing manufacturers to publish repair manuals and offer genuine spare parts. Third the phase out of legacy ports USB A HDMI in favor of Thunderbolt 4 5 and USB C is accelerating adoption of docking stations and universal accessories. Another notable shift is the growing subscription model for hardware. Programs like PC as a Service allow businesses to lease devices with bundled support and upgrade cycles. Finally the US government CHIPS Act incentives are encouraging domestic semiconductor production which could moderate price volatility and reduce reliance on overseas fabrication.

Segment Analysis


US Laptop Market By Type
• In the U.S. laptop market, traditional laptops make up the majority share. Their average selling price ASP has been pushed into the 1100 to 1300 range, largely due to the high costs of cutting edge components in premium devices. On the consumer versus commercial front, enterprise demand is currently the strongest growth driver. For example, while the overall PC market in early 2025 saw 15 percent growth, the commercial segment grew by 8 percent, directly contrasting a 4 percent decline in the consumer market.
• The 2 in 1 laptop segment is highly competitive, with Apple leveraging its ecosystem and design to take a leading position. In fact, Apple has captured a dominant 25 percent of the global 2 in 1 market in terms of revenue, while close rivals HP and Microsoft follow with roughly 15 percent and 10 percent shares respectively. This shift towards convertible and detachable designs also commands a premium price, with ASPs generally 50 to 200 higher than traditional models, typically falling in the 1300 to 1500 range.

US Laptop Market By Application
• The commercial segment is currently the primary engine of the market and is expected to grow by 8% in 2025 as enterprises refresh their Windows 11 hardware. HP leads with a 25% share followed closely by Dell with 23% and Lenovo with 18.4%. Apple is also emerging as a growing force in enterprises increasing its share to 11% in 2025. For personal and small business use brands like Apple and HP are highly preferred with each commanding a 25% consumer mindshare alongside Dell. At the premium end of the business market including the education sector Apple average selling price ASP is significantly higher at 1425 dollars highlighting its premium value in professional applications.
• The gaming laptop market is highly concentrated with Lenovo as the undisputed leader holding a dominant 42% share in the consumer gaming segment. ASUS is its primary rival securing 32.1% of the market supported by its popular ROG and TUF series. The remaining market is fragmented with competitors such as MSI and Acer holding smaller shares. This specialization comes at a premium as gaming laptop configurations generally represent the higher end of laptop pricing.

US Laptop Market By Screen Size
• The 11-12.9 inch segment primarily caters to education-focused Chromebooks, entry-level Windows laptops, and a few premium ultra-mobile devices. It represents around 10% of the U.S. laptop market, with average selling prices ranging between $300 and $500 due to the dominance of affordable school-oriented devices. Lenovo, HP, and Dell Technologies are the leading brands in this category.
• The 13-14.9 inch segment is the second-largest category in the U.S. laptop market, accounting for nearly 35% of total sales. It is highly preferred by professionals, students, and mainstream consumers seeking a balance between portability and productivity, with average selling prices ranging from $900 to $1,300. Premium models from Apple, Dell Technologies (XPS series), and Lenovo (ThinkPad series) dominate the segment.

US Laptop Market By Distribution Channel The online channel accounts for an estimated 55-60% of U.S. laptop sales value, driven by strong demand for configurable premium laptops, gaming notebooks, and direct-to-consumer purchases. The average selling price ASP in this channel is relatively high, typically ranging between $900 and $1,300, as consumers purchasing online tend to prefer premium specifications and higher-end models.
• Offline sales continue to play a major role in the U.S. laptop market, especially for enterprise procurement, education purchases, and consumers seeking in-store demonstrations and support. The average selling price ASP in offline retail is comparatively lower, generally ranging between $650 and $950, reflecting the higher mix of mainstream consumer and education-oriented devices sold through physical stores.
